What are miracle questions, exception-finding questions, and scaling questions, and how are they used in family therapy?

The therapist asks the client to imagine waking up one day and a miracle has occurred overnight, and their problems have disappeared. The client is then asked to describe in detail what their life would look like, how they would feel, and what they would be doing Show more…
